Customer Service Representative
First, you go to the ground floor and give your resume to the person in charge. If you were referred by an employee, you'll meet the receptionist first. Then, you'll need to sign up on the [24]7 Springboard website and write your ID on your resume, along with your referrer's name and employee ID. After that, you'll have an initial interview where you'll be asked to talk about yourself and get some feedback. Then, there's a wait before the first round of interviews. This first round is similar to the initial chat. After another wait, if you're going for a voice role, you'll do a Voice and Accent assessment. For non-voice roles, you'll write a short essay on your resume. For voice roles, you'll take a call in a cabin, which has three parts: first, another self-introduction; second, a 2-3 minute talk on a given topic, making sure to keep speaking without pauses or fillers; and third, you'll act as a representative, either selling something or solving a problem, focusing on politeness and getting user input. After a wait, you'll get a test score from 1-20, which helps determine your role. Aim for at least 10 points in the previous step. After lunch, you'll have an HR interview, also known as the operations round. Here, just like before, don't be silent and try to impress them with your words. They're looking at your attitude towards life and your career. Make sure they don't think you're unstable and that you plan to stay with them for a long time. After another wait, you'll either get the job offer or be asked to come back in about a month. Finally, you'll submit your documents either the next day or on a date given. There are 3 interview rounds in total.

Customer Service Representative
A recruiter reached out to me, and I didn't even realize they were the company I'd be working for. Then, I was invited to a group assessment. It started with introductions and mentioning who we'd like to meet. After that, we went into a room to wait for a phone call to do a mock customer inquiry. Those who did well in that part then had an interview.
